Key Details of the Isuzu 4JA1 Engine
The Isuzu 4JA1 engine is valued for its reliable construction and efficient performance. This diesel four-cylinder unit incorporates a displacement of 2.5 liters, achieving a harmony of performance and fuel efficiency. With a opening diameter of 91 mm and a stroke of 102 mm, it achieves efficient combustion. The engine is installed with a direct fuel injection system, strengthening its reaction and capabilities across different operational scenarios.
It functions with a compression rate of 22.0:1, contributing to its torque characteristics and overall reliability. The 4JA1 engine generally generates around 75 to 90 horsepower, based on the specific application and calibration. Additionally, it is engineered to support various transmission options, rendering it adaptable for different vehicle types. Essential Care Guidelines to Extend the Lifespan of Your 4JA1 Engine
To preserve the durability of the Isuzu 4JA1 engine, routine upkeep is essential. Regular oil replacements using high-quality oil keep internal components lubricated and reduce wear. Checking and swapping the air filter consistently ensures optimal air circulation, enhancing engine efficiency. Moreover, monitoring coolant levels and examining the cooling system help avoid overheating, a common issue for diesel engines.
Periodically checking hose and belt systems for evidence of damage can prevent mechanical failures. Preserving the fuel injection system clean by using quality fuel and periodic fuel filter changes supports efficient combustion. Moreover, ensuring adequate tire pressure and alignment not only improves fuel economy but also reduces strain on the engine.
In conclusion, following the manufacturer's recommended service intervals guarantees that all parts operate efficiently. By implementing these maintenance tips, owners can significantly prolong the life of their Isuzu 4JA1 engine, ensuring dependable performance over the long term.
Addressing Prevalent Complications With the 4JA1 Engine
Regular service can assist in preventing many issues related to the Isuzu 4JA1 engine, though problems may still occur over time. Overheating is one common problem, often due to a faulty thermostat or a clogged radiator. It is important for drivers to regularly check coolant levels and look for leaks in the cooling system. Poor fuel efficiency is another frequent problem, often resulting from clogged fuel filters or faulty injectors. Keeping these parts clean can boost performance. Additionally, unusual noises might point to worn bearings or timing belt concerns; early diagnosis is vital to avoid significant damage. Finally, smoke from the exhaust may indicate combustion issues, possibly caused by worn piston rings or valve seals. Addressing these issues quickly and consulting a qualified mechanic can maximize the lifespan and dependability of the 4JA1 engine, helping it continues to work at its peak.
